ISLAMABAD: The government on Saturday appointed Lt Gen (retd) Nazir Ahmed as new chairman of Pakistan’s National Accountability Bureau (NAB). Pakistan’s Prime Minister House issued a notification about the appointment of new chairman NAB.

The notification stated that consultation between the Prime Minister and the Leader of the Opposition in the National Assembly has been held and there was a consensus on the name of Lt. Gen (Retd.) Nazir Ahmad, for his appointment by the government as Chairman, NAB.

The office of the NAB chairman became vacant on Feb, 15 following the acceptance of the resignation of Aftab Sultan, the notification added.

It maintained that following “detailed deliberations”, both sides agreed over the appointment of Lt Gen (retd) Ahmad as chairman NAB.

According to the ministry of law, the NAB chairman shall hold post for a “non-extendable term of 3 years”.

The notification added that it is also impossible to remove the NAB chairman from office except on the grounds as defined in Article 209 of the Constitution of Pakistan.
